Zarządzanie aukcjami Allegro bezpośrednio z WooCommerce znacząco ułatwia codzienną pracę właścicieli sklepów internetowych. Dzięki wtyczce Allegro WooCommerce możliwe jest wygodne wystawianie ofert, automatyczna synchronizacja stanów magazynowych oraz intuicyjne mapowanie kategorii i parametrów Allegro. Czasami jednak pojawiają się sytuacje, które wymagają dokładniejszej analizy i wspólnego działania – zarówno po stronie wsparcia technicznego, jak i samego użytkownika. W tym artykule przedstawiamy prawdziwy przypadek, który zakończył się sukcesem właśnie dzięki takiej współpracy.
Opis sytuacji: brak widocznej kategorii we wtyczce Allegro WooCommerce
Jeden z użytkowników wtyczki zauważył, że podczas wystawiania aukcji na Allegro w kategorii:
Kolekcje i sztuka → Kolekcje → Akcesoria alkoholowe → Winiarstwo → Przechowywanie
…nie widzi wszystkich podkategorii dostępnych na stronie Allegro. Chociaż na portalu Allegro widoczne były aż 5 podkategorii, w panelu integracji wtyczki WooCommerce pojawiały się tylko 3: Beczki, Butelki i Korkownice. Zabrakło m.in. pozycji Regały/stojaki, co uniemożliwiało wystawienie oferty w tej konkretnej kategorii z poziomu WooCommerce.
Użytkownik zapytał, czy problem wynika z nieaktualnej wersji wtyczki, czy może to Allegro nie udostępnia pełnej struktury kategorii.
Analiza przypadku i rozwiązanie krok po kroku
1. Weryfikacja wtyczki Allegro WooCommerce i drzewa kategorii
Pierwszym krokiem była próba odtworzenia sytuacji w najnowszej wersji wtyczki (5.5.8). Szybko potwierdziliśmy, że także w aktualnym wydaniu struktura kategorii kończy się na trzech podkategoriach. Nie pomagała ani ponowna synchronizacja, ani zmiana ustawień.
➡️ Wniosek: Problem nie dotyczył wersji wtyczki – dane pobierane z API Allegro po prostu nie zawierały brakującej kategorii.
2. Testowanie identyfikatora kategorii
Na podstawie linku do brakującej kategorii:
https://allegro.pl/kategoria/przechowywanie-regaly-stojaki-255977
wyciągnęliśmy ID: 255977 i sprawdziliśmy go bezpośrednio poprzez zapytanie do API Allegro:
GET https://api.allegro.pl/sale/categories/255977
Odpowiedź API:
{
"errors": [
{
"code": "ERROR",
"message": "Category '255977' not found",
"details": "ResourceNotFoundException"
}
]
}
➡️ Wniosek: Choć kategoria jest widoczna na stronie Allegro, nie jest dostępna w ich API. Oznacza to, że integracja WooCommerce nie ma do niej dostępu, a wystawienie oferty z tej kategorii z poziomu wtyczki staje się niemożliwe.
3. Konsultacja z zespołem deweloperskim
Po naszej stronie sprawa została przekazana do zespołu programistów, ponieważ podobne przypadki pojawiały się już wcześniej. Niestety, do dziś nie udało się jednoznacznie ustalić, dlaczego niektóre kategorie są widoczne w interfejsie Allegro, ale niedostępne w API. Wygląda na to, że Allegro stosuje różne ścieżki aliasów kategorii, z których tylko część jest publicznie udostępniana.
➡️ Dla przejrzystości i monitorowania przygotowaliśmy wewnętrzne zgłoszenie techniczne, ale nie byliśmy w stanie zaproponować natychmiastowego rozwiązania.
4. Wspólne odkrycie – kluczowa obserwacja użytkownika
I tu pojawił się przełom. To użytkownik samodzielnie dokonał dodatkowej analizy i zauważył, że interesująca go kategoria może znajdować się również w innej gałęzi drzewa Allegro.
Zamiast struktury:
Kolekcje → Akcesoria alkoholowe → Winiarstwo → Przechowywanie
…kategoria „Regały/stojaki” występuje też jako:
Dom i Ogród → Wyposażenie → Przechowywanie → Stojaki na wino
Ten wariant ma ID 261604 – i co istotne, działa poprawnie w API Allegro.
➡️ Rozwiązanie: wystawianie ofert można kontynuować, przypisując produkty do tej alternatywnej, dostępnej w API kategorii.
Jak wtyczka Allegro WooCommerce pomogła w rozwiązaniu problemu
Choć problem wynikał z ograniczeń po stronie Allegro, wtyczka Allegro WooCommerce umożliwiła szybkie testowanie różnych ID kategorii, przypisanie właściwej oraz kontynuację sprzedaży. Elastyczność integracji i otwartość na ręczne dostosowania pozwoliły na obejście ograniczenia bez konieczności zmiany platformy czy całkowitej rezygnacji z automatyzacji.
To rozwiązanie nie byłoby jednak możliwe bez zaangażowania użytkownika, który wrócił do nas z cenną obserwacją. To doskonały przykład partnerskiej współpracy – gdzie zarówno klient, jak i zespół wsparcia technicznego wspólnie szukają optymalnego wyjścia z sytuacji.
Podsumowanie i wnioski
Ten przypadek pokazuje, że nawet dobrze działające API zewnętrzne (takie jak Allegro) mogą mieć swoje ograniczenia i niuanse, które wpływają na integracje z WooCommerce. Kluczowe czynniki sukcesu w tym przypadku to:
- 🔍 dokładna analiza komunikacji z API,
- 🧠 inicjatywa użytkownika w poszukiwaniu alternatyw,
- 🤝 efektywna współpraca z zespołem wsparcia technicznego.
Wtyczka skontaktuj się z nami – chętnie pomożemy!